By creating a chimera of Broccoli RNAs with mixed chemistries, it is possible to develop an effective RNA-based fluorescent K+ sensor that maintains structure and fluorescence properties without interference, providing linear fluorescent gain across physiological K+ concentrations.
The RNA aptamer Broccoli accepts 2 ' fluorinated (2 ' F) pyrimidine nucleotide incorporation without perturbation of structure or fluorescence in the presence of potassium and DFHBI. However, the modification decreases Broccoli's apparent affinity for K+ >30-fold. A chimera of Broccoli RNAs with mixed chemistries displays linear fluorescent gain spanning physiological K+ concentrations, yielding an effective RNA-based fluorescent K+ sensor.
